Factors to Consider When Choosing Luggage for China Travel

When choosing luggage for travel in China, consider several important factors. Size is crucial. China's trains and buses have limited space for large bags. A medium-sized suitcase or a sturdy backpack might fit better. Think about the weight as well. Lightweight luggage can save on airline fees and make it easier to carry.

Durability is a key point. China’s varied climate and terrain can be tough on luggage. Look for water-resistant materials. These will protect your belongings from unexpected rain or spills. Additionally, consider security features. A built-in lock or a combination is invaluable in busy areas.

Tips: Choose luggage with wheels for easy mobility. This will help you navigate crowded streets or public transport with ease. Also, think about organization. Multiple compartments can keep your items tidy and accessible. It's frustrating to dig through a cluttered bag when you need something quickly. Test it yourself; practice packing and unpacking to find the system that works best for you.

Size and Weight Restrictions for Domestic Travel in China

When traveling domestically in China, understanding size and weight restrictions is vital. According to the Civil Aviation Administration of China (CAAC), the average checked luggage limit is around 20 to 32 kilograms, depending on the airline. Each passenger is typically allowed one piece of checked luggage and one carry-on bag. These restrictions can vary, so checking specific airline policies is recommended.

Carry-on luggage must be manageable. Most airlines permit a maximum size of 55 cm x 40 cm x 20 cm. Weighing your bag beforehand is wise. Overweight fees can add up quickly. Some travelers find themselves facing unexpected charges at the airport. For those using trains, luggage rules are even stricter at times. Passengers should aim for a total of 20 kilograms for all bags combined.
